Common Reasons Why Your AirPods Battery Drains Fast
1. Battery Health Degrades Over Time
AirPods use tiny lithium-ion batteries that wear out after hundreds of charging cycles, especially with regular use.
2. The Charging Case Isn’t Working Properly
A faulty or aging case might not fully charge the AirPods, making them die faster than expected.
3. Outdated Firmware
Old firmware can lead to power bugs or syncing issues that drain the battery quickly.
4. Always-On Features
Features like auto ear detection, “Hey Siri,” or noise cancellation (on Pro models) drain power faster even when not in use.
5. Dirty or Blocked Charging Contacts
Dirt, earwax, or dust buildup in the case or on the AirPods can block charging and cause a faster drain.

Quick Fixes to Try Before Replacing the Battery
Before you consider replacing your AirPods battery, try these simple solutions that may resolve the issue:
Reset Your AirPods
A quick reset can clear minor glitches that cause excessive battery drain.Clean the AirPods and Charging Case
Use a dry, soft brush or cotton swab to gently clean the charging contacts. Dust or debris may block proper charging.Turn Off Power-Hungry Features
Disable features like “Hey Siri” and Automatic Ear Detection in your Bluetooth settings to conserve battery life.Update to the Latest Firmware
Ensure your AirPods are running the latest firmware version to avoid bugs that may cause fast battery drain.
If these steps don’t help, your AirPods battery may be worn out, especially if they’ve been used daily for over a year. In that case, a battery replacement might be the best solution.
